DINA SHERIF

Counsel

Dina joined ADSERO – Ragy Soliman & Partners in 2020. She has over nine years of experience in general commercial, M&As and capital markets with top-tier law firms in Egypt.

Prior to joining ADSERO, Dina worked at the Egyptian Competition Authority, where she provided legal analysis and recommendations to several governmental bodies in relation to competition laws and regulations, as well as conducting legal investigations on Egyptian entities in relation to anti-trust conducts within the various Egyptian markets. After that, she worked at , focusing on mergers and acquisitions and capital markets practices.

Dina has vast experience in drafting and reviewing all types of commercial agreements, providing legal advice on transactional & non-transactional corporate and regulatory matters, advising on restructuring plans and strategies for regional and multinational companies, executing M&A transactions,  including conducting legal due diligence, conducting legal research, drafting and reviewing transaction documentation. Dina also has experience representing major Egyptian companies in primary and secondary offerings on the EGX in the context of IPOs and representing regional and multinational companies in connection with the Mandatory Tender Offers (MTO).

Dina has represented numerous private equities in high-profile transactions, including Gulf Capital and TCV, as well as representing several national and multinational companies through a wide range of industries, including AXA, Abou Zaabal Fertilizers, Alcazar Energy, Cairo 3A, Cargill, Danone, Delivery Hero, Regus, TCI Sanmar Chemicals, Techno Group and Uber.

Dina also advised several TMT companies (e.g., Etisalat and Sony) on regulatory matters, interconnection agreements, and software license agreements.
